ValidateContext Klass

Definition

Representerar kontexten för validering av ett validatable-objekt.

public ref class ValidateContext sealed
[System.Diagnostics.CodeAnalysis.Experimental("ASP0029", UrlFormat="https://aka.ms/aspnet/analyzer/{0}")]
public sealed class ValidateContext
[<System.Diagnostics.CodeAnalysis.Experimental("ASP0029", UrlFormat="https://aka.ms/aspnet/analyzer/{0}")>]
type ValidateContext = class
Public NotInheritable Class ValidateContext
Arv
ValidateContext
Attribut

Konstruktorer

Name Description
ValidateContext()
Föråldrad.

Representerar kontexten för validering av ett validatable-objekt.

Egenskaper

Name Description
CurrentDepth

Hämtar eller anger det aktuella djupet i valideringshierarkin.

CurrentValidationPath

Hämtar eller anger prefixet som används för att identifiera det aktuella objektet som verifieras i ett komplext objektdiagram.

ValidationContext

Hämtar eller anger verifieringskontexten som används för att verifiera objekt som implementerar IValidatableObject eller har ValidationAttribute. Den här kontexten ger åtkomst till tjänstleverantören och andra valideringsmetadata.

ValidationErrors

Hämtar eller anger ordlistan över valideringsfel som samlats in under valideringen.

ValidationOptions

Hämtar eller anger de valideringsalternativ som styr valideringsbeteendet, inklusive begränsningar för valideringsdjup och matchningsregistrering.

Händelser

Name Description
OnValidationError

Valfri händelse som genereras när ett verifieringsfel rapporteras.

Gäller för